fre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

用順序結(jié)構(gòu)表示棧并實現(xiàn)棧的各種基本操作(存儲版)

2025-07-30 23:40上一頁面

下一頁面
  

【正文】 該現(xiàn)象稱為假上溢現(xiàn)象。 /*初始化申請空間*/qfront=1。 printf(%d, qqueue[s])。 int rear。 qqueue[qrear]=x。}/*取隊頭元素*/int gethead(sqqueue *q){ if (qfront==qrear) return 0。 } printf(\n)。 for (i=0。 do{printf(\n第一次使用請初始化!\n)。 printf(6取隊頭元素 \n)。 } case 2: { Setsqqueue(head)。 display(head)。 break。2. 若不是心寬似海,哪有人生風平浪靜。你必須努力,當有一天驀然回首時,你的回憶里才會多一些色彩斑斕,少一些蒼白無力。4. 歲月是無情的,假如你丟給它的是一片空白,它還給你的也是一片空白。 } } }while(select=7)。 } case 5: { if(Empty(head)) printf(隊列空\n)。x)。 printf(已經(jīng)初始化順序隊列!\n)。 printf(4出隊 \n)。 int x,y,z,select。n)。 while(sqrear) {s=s+1。}/*判斷隊列是否為空*/int Empty(sqqueue *q){ if (qfront==qrear) return TRUE。} /*入隊*/int append(sqqueue *q, Elemtype x) { if(qrear=MAXNUM1) return FALSE。} } /*利用入隊函數(shù)快速輸入數(shù)據(jù)*/【參考程序】include include define MAXNUM 100define Elemtype intdefine TRUE 1define FALSE 0typedef struct{ Elemtype queue[MAXNUM]。}/*取隊頭元素函數(shù)*/int gethead(sqqueue *q){return(qqueue[qfront+1])。}sqqueue。由于入隊和出隊操作中,頭尾指針只增加不減小,致使被刪元素的空間永遠無法重新利用。出隊時,刪去front所指的元素,然后將front加1并返回被刪元素。 }break。m)。i++) {scanf(%d,amp。 Disp(s)。 printf(\n 5 置空鏈棧 \n)。 do{ printf(\n)。 while (p!=NULL) { printf(%d\n,pdata)。 //釋放 return x。 //插入}/*出棧*/Elemtype popLstack(LinkStack * s){ Elemtype x。 printf(\n鏈棧被置空!\n)。typedef struct stacknode { Elemtype data。 stop=p。/*初始化鏈棧函數(shù)*/void InitStack(LinkStack * s){ s=(LinkStack *)malloc(sizeof(LinkStack))。注意:(1)LinkStack結(jié)構(gòu)類型的定義可以方便地在函數(shù)體中修改top指針本身(2)若要記錄棧中元素個數(shù),可將元素個數(shù)屬性放在LinkStack類型中定義。 OutStack(q)。 OutStack(q)。 }break。 printf(\n\n)。 printf(\n)。i=0。 return(x)。 if(ptop!=0) { x=pstack[ptop]。 int top。 } /*數(shù)據(jù)入棧*/}/*出棧函數(shù)*/ElemType Pop(SqStack *p){x=pstack[ptop]。否則出現(xiàn)空間溢出,引起錯誤,這種現(xiàn)象稱為上溢。注意:(1)順序棧中元素用向量存放(2)棧底位置是固定不變的,可設置在向量兩端的任意一個端點(3)棧頂位置是隨著進棧和退棧操作而變化的,用一個整型量top(通常稱top為棧頂指針)來指示當前棧頂位置【實現(xiàn)提示】/*定義順序棧的存儲結(jié)構(gòu)*/typedef struct { ElemType stack[MAXNUM]。}/*遍歷順序棧函數(shù)*/void OutStack(SqStack *p){ for(i=ptop。 ptop=1。 return(x)。 }}/*遍歷順序棧*/void OutStack(SqStack *p){ int i。}/*主函數(shù)*/main(){ SqStack *q。 printf(\n 2 插入一個元素 \n)。cord)。a)。
點擊復制文檔內(nèi)容
環(huán)評公示相關推薦
文庫吧 www.dybbs8.com
備案圖鄂ICP備17016276號-1